Hirsch Summary
A wanted to borrow 1,000 florins from B. Since B had no cash, he gave A a four percent government bond and told him that after a certain time, he should return this bond or another of equal value. Is this usury, and what about the coupons, even if the returned bond has an interest coupon due later than the coupon of the bond given by B? Salomo Jessurun decides that this is not usury, and the payment of the due coupons does not violate the Torah's prohibition on interest.
